//! Methods for building transactions.
|
|
|
|
use crate::{
|
|
amount::{Amount, NonNegative},
|
|
block::Height,
|
|
parameters::{Network, NetworkUpgrade},
|
|
transaction::{LockTime, Transaction},
|
|
transparent,
|
|
};
|
|
|
|
impl Transaction {
|
|
/// Returns a new version 5 coinbase transaction for `network` and `height`,
|
|
/// which contains the specified `outputs`.
|
|
pub fn new_v5_coinbase(
|
|
network: &Network,
|
|
height: Height,
|
|
outputs: impl IntoIterator<Item = (Amount<NonNegative>, transparent::Script)>,
|
|
extra_coinbase_data: Vec<u8>,
|
|
) -> Transaction {
|
|
// # Consensus
|
|
//
|
|
// These consensus rules apply to v5 coinbase transactions after NU5 activation:
|
|
//
|
|
// > If effectiveVersion ≥ 5 then this condition MUST hold:
|
|
// > tx_in_count > 0 or nSpendsSapling > 0 or
|
|
// > (nActionsOrchard > 0 and enableSpendsOrchard = 1).
|
|
//
|
|
// > A coinbase transaction for a block at block height greater than 0 MUST have
|
|
// > a script that, as its first item, encodes the block height height as follows. ...
|
|
// > let heightBytes be the signed little-endian representation of height,
|
|
// > using the minimum nonzero number of bytes such that the most significant byte
|
|
// > is < 0x80. The length of heightBytes MUST be in the range {1 .. 5}.
|
|
// > Then the encoding is the length of heightBytes encoded as one byte,
|
|
// > followed by heightBytes itself. This matches the encoding used by Bitcoin
|
|
// > in the implementation of [BIP-34]
|
|
// > (but the description here is to be considered normative).
|
|
//
|
|
// > A coinbase transaction script MUST have length in {2 .. 100} bytes.
|
|
//
|
|
// Zebra adds extra coinbase data if configured to do so.
|
|
//
|
|
// Since we're not using a lock time, any sequence number is valid here.
|
|
// See `Transaction::lock_time()` for the relevant consensus rules.
|
|
//
|
|
// <https://zips.z.cash/protocol/protocol.pdf#txnconsensus>
|
|
let inputs = vec![transparent::Input::new_coinbase(
|
|
height,
|
|
Some(extra_coinbase_data),
|
|
None,
|
|
)];
|
|
|
|
// > The block subsidy is composed of a miner subsidy and a series of funding streams.
|
|
//
|
|
// <https://zips.z.cash/protocol/protocol.pdf#subsidyconcepts>
|
|
//
|
|
// > The total value in zatoshi of transparent outputs from a coinbase transaction,
|
|
// > minus vbalanceSapling, minus vbalanceOrchard, MUST NOT be greater than
|
|
// > the value in zatoshi of block subsidy plus the transaction fees
|
|
// > paid by transactions in this block.
|
|
//
|
|
// > If effectiveVersion ≥ 5 then this condition MUST hold:
|
|
// > tx_out_count > 0 or nOutputsSapling > 0 or
|
|
// > (nActionsOrchard > 0 and enableOutputsOrchard = 1).
|
|
//
|
|
// <https://zips.z.cash/protocol/protocol.pdf#txnconsensus>
|
|
let outputs: Vec<_> = outputs
|
|
.into_iter()
|
|
.map(|(amount, lock_script)| transparent::Output::new_coinbase(amount, lock_script))
|
|
.collect();
|
|
assert!(
|
|
!outputs.is_empty(),
|
|
"invalid coinbase transaction: must have at least one output"
|
|
);
|
|
|
|
Transaction::V5 {
|
|
// > The transaction version number MUST be 4 or 5. ...
|
|
// > If the transaction version number is 5 then the version group ID
|
|
// > MUST be 0x26A7270A.
|
|
// > If effectiveVersion ≥ 5, the nConsensusBranchId field MUST match the consensus
|
|
// > branch ID used for SIGHASH transaction hashes, as specified in [ZIP-244].
|
|
network_upgrade: NetworkUpgrade::current(network, height),
|
|
|
|
// There is no documented consensus rule for the lock time field in coinbase
|
|
// transactions, so we just leave it unlocked. (We could also set it to `height`.)
|
|
lock_time: LockTime::unlocked(),
|
|
|
|
// > The nExpiryHeight field of a coinbase transaction MUST be equal to its
|
|
// > block height.
|
|
expiry_height: height,
|
|
|
|
inputs,
|
|
outputs,
|
|
|
|
// Zebra does not support shielded coinbase yet.
|
|
//
|
|
// > In a version 5 coinbase transaction, the enableSpendsOrchard flag MUST be 0.
|
|
// > In a version 5 transaction, the reserved bits 2 .. 7 of the flagsOrchard field
|
|
// > MUST be zero.
|
|
//
|
|
// See the Zcash spec for additional shielded coinbase consensus rules.
|
|
sapling_shielded_data: None,
|
|
orchard_shielded_data: None,
|
|
}
|
|
}

/// Returns a new version 4 coinbase transaction for `network` and `height`,
|
|
/// which contains the specified `outputs`.
|
|
///
|
|
/// If `like_zcashd` is true, try to match the coinbase transactions generated by `zcashd`
|
|
/// in the `getblocktemplate` RPC.
|
|
pub fn new_v4_coinbase(
|
|
_network: &Network,
|
|
height: Height,
|
|
outputs: impl IntoIterator<Item = (Amount<NonNegative>, transparent::Script)>,
|
|
like_zcashd: bool,
|
|
extra_coinbase_data: Vec<u8>,
|
|
) -> Transaction {
|
|
let mut extra_data = None;
|
|
let mut sequence = None;
|
|
|
|
// `zcashd` includes an extra byte after the coinbase height in the coinbase data,
|
|
// and a sequence number of u32::MAX.
|
|
if like_zcashd {
|
|
extra_data = Some(vec![0x00]);
|
|
sequence = Some(u32::MAX);
|
|
}
|
|
|
|
// Override like_zcashd if extra_coinbase_data was supplied
|
|
if !extra_coinbase_data.is_empty() {
|
|
extra_data = Some(extra_coinbase_data);
|
|
}
|
|
|
|
// # Consensus
|
|
//
|
|
// See the other consensus rules above in new_v5_coinbase().
|
|
//
|
|
// > If effectiveVersion < 5, then at least one of tx_in_count, nSpendsSapling,
|
|
// > and nJoinSplit MUST be nonzero.
|
|
let inputs = vec![transparent::Input::new_coinbase(
|
|
height, extra_data, sequence,
|
|
)];
|
|
|
|
// > If effectiveVersion < 5, then at least one of tx_out_count, nOutputsSapling,
|
|
// > and nJoinSplit MUST be nonzero.
|
|
let outputs: Vec<_> = outputs
|
|
.into_iter()
|
|
.map(|(amount, lock_script)| transparent::Output::new_coinbase(amount, lock_script))
|
|
.collect();
|
|
assert!(
|
|
!outputs.is_empty(),
|
|
"invalid coinbase transaction: must have at least one output"
|
|
);
|
|
|
|
// > The transaction version number MUST be 4 or 5. ...
|
|
// > If the transaction version number is 4 then the version group ID MUST be 0x892F2085.
|
|
Transaction::V4 {
|
|
lock_time: LockTime::unlocked(),
|
|
|
|
expiry_height: height,
|
|
|
|
inputs,
|
|
outputs,
|
|
|
|
// Zebra does not support shielded coinbase yet.
|
|
joinsplit_data: None,
|
|
sapling_shielded_data: None,
|
|
}
|
|
}
|
|
}
